Strategies for Avoiding Jury Selection in Legal Cases

Navigating the intricacies of jury selection can be a critical aspect of legal cases. Here are some strategic approaches that can help in avoiding certain types of jurors during this process: 1. Thorough Voir Dire: Voir dire is the process where potential jurors are questioned to determine their suitability for the case. By asking precise and probing questions during this phase, attorneys can uncover biases or preconceived notions that may disqualify a juror from serving. 2. Understand Legal Standards: Familiarize yourself with the legal standards for dismissing jurors. In the U.S., jurors can be dismissed for cause if they demonstrate an inability to be impartial or unbiased. Understanding these standards can help in identifying jurors who may need to be excused. 3. Use Peremptory Challenges Wisely: Peremptory challenges allow attorneys to dismiss a juror without providing a reason. Average Lawyer Retainer Fee for Divorce: What You Need to Know

When facing the challenging journey of divorce, one crucial aspect to consider is the lawyer retainer fee. This fee serves as a lifeline in navigating the legal complexities ahead. The average retainer fee for a divorce lawyer can vary significantly depending on various factors such as location, attorney experience, and the complexity of the case. It is essential to understand that a retainer fee is an upfront cost paid to secure the services of a lawyer. This fee is deposited into a dedicated account and is drawn upon as legal services are provided. The average retainer fee for a divorce lawyer typ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000. However, in high-conflict divorces or cases involving substantial assets, this fee can escalate to $10,000 or more. Understanding Average Injury Lawyer Fees: What You Need to Know

Understanding Average Injury Lawyer Fees: What You Need to Know Have you ever found yourself in a situation where you needed a personal injury lawyer, but the thought of the associated fees made you hesitant to seek justice? It’s a common concern that many people face. However, understanding average injury lawyer fees can help demystify the process and empower you to make informed decisions. When it comes to personal injury cases, lawyers typically work on a contingency fee basis. This means that they only get paid if they win your case. The standard contingency fee ranges from 33% to 40% of the settlement amount, although this can vary based on the complexity of the case and the lawyer’s experience. Analyzing the Average Costs of Clinical Trials by Phase

Clinical trials are crucial for advancing medical research and bringing new treatments to patients. These trials are conducted in several phases to ensure the safety and efficacy of the drugs or medical devices being tested. It’s essential to understand the average costs associated with each phase of a clinical trial to appreciate the resources required for this important work. Phase 1: In Phase 1 clinical trials, the focus is on testing the safety of the drug or treatment in a small group of healthy volunteers. The average cost for a Phase 1 trial can range from $1 million to $5 million. This phase is vital for determining initial safety profiles and dosage levels. Phase 2: Phase 2 trials involve a larger group of patients to evaluate the effectiveness of the treatment and further assess its safety. Avelumab Treatment for Ovarian Cancer: What You Need to Know

Ovarian cancer is a challenging diagnosis that requires comprehensive treatment strategies. Avelumab, a promising immunotherapy drug, has emerged as a beacon of hope in the battle against this resilient disease. Here’s what you need to know about Avelumab treatment for ovarian cancer: 1. How Avelumab Works: Avelumab is a type of immunotherapy that works by harnessing the power of the immune system to target and destroy cancer cells. It does this by blocking a protein called PD-L1, which cancer cells use to evade detection by the immune system. By inhibiting PD-L1, Avelumab helps the immune system recognize and attack the cancer cells. 2. How to Properly Draft an Authorization Letter for Apostille

Drafting an authorization letter for an Apostille requires attention to detail and precision to ensure the document is legally sound and serves its intended purpose. An Apostille is a certificate issued by a designated authority that authenticates the signature and seal of a document for use in another country. To draft the authorization letter effectively, consider the following key steps: Identify the Parties: Clearly identify the parties involved – the individual granting authorization (the principal) and the authorized representative. Include their full names, addresses, and contact information. State the Purpose: Explicitly state the purpose of the authorization, outlining the specific actions the authorized representative is permitted to take on behalf of the principal. Be precise and detailed to avoid any ambiguity. Specify Limitations: If there are any limitations or restrictions on the authority granted, such as a specific timeframe or scope of actions, clearly outline these in the letter to avoid any misunderstandings. Understanding the Authorization Agreement Contract: MOU vs. MOA

Understanding the Authorization Agreement Contract: MOU vs. MOA In the realm of legal agreements, two terms often surface: MOU (Memorandum of Understanding) and MOA (Memorandum of Agreement). While they may sound similar, these documents serve distinct purposes and carry different implications. Memorandum of Understanding (MOU): An MOU is like a handshake in writing. It signifies a mutual understanding between two or more parties about their shared objectives and intentions. This document outlines the terms and conditions of collaboration or cooperation without creating a legally binding contract. MOUs are commonly used in situations where parties are exploring potential partnerships or joint ventures and want to establish a framework for future negotiations. Memorandum of Agreement (MOA): On the other hand, an MOA goes a step further by formalizing the commitments made in the MOU.
